How much do cobol engineer salary j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 24, 2026, the average hourly pay for cobol engineer salary in the United States is $57.03,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$48.08 and $86.54 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ges Cobol engineers face when working on legacy systems?

Cobol Engineers often encounter challenges such as limited or outdated documentation, which can make understanding and modifying existing codebases difficult. Additionally, integrating COBOL applications with modern technologies and platforms requires creative problem-solving and a strong grasp of both legacy and contemporary systems. Collaboration with business analysts and other IT professionals is crucial to ensure that updates do not disrupt critical business operations, especially in industries like banking or insurance where COBOL systems play a vital role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Cobol eng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a COBOL Engineer, you need strong proficiency in COBOL programming, legacy systems maintenance, and a solid understanding of mainframe environments, usually backed by a degree in computer science or related experience. Familiarity with tools like IBM z/OS, JCL, DB2, and version control systems is typically required, along with any relevant mainframe certifications. Anal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ective teamwork are crucial soft skills in this role. These skills are important because they ensure reliable support and modernization of mission-critical legacy systems that many large organizations still depend on.

Are Cobol Engineer jobs still in demand?

Cobol Engineer jobs remain in demand in industries such as banking, finance, and government, where legacy systems still rely on COBOL programming. Many organizations seek experienced professionals for maintenance, modernization, and migration projects, often requiring knowledge of mainframe environments and related tools.

How much do Cobol engineers get paid?

Cobol engineers typically earn between $70,000 and $120,000 annually, depending on experience, location, and industry. Senior roles or those with specialized skills in mainframe environments may command higher salaries, especially with certifications or extensive legacy system knowledge.

We are seeking a highly skilled and experienced Mainframe COBOL Developer to join our technology team.
The successful candidate will be responsible for the design, development, testing, and implementation of COBOL-based applications on our mainframe systems. This role involves working with complex business logic and ensuring the stability and performance of mission-critical applications.
Responsibilities:
Design, develop, and maintain mainframe applications using COBOL, JCL, DB2, CICS and VSAM.
Analyze business requirements and translate them into technical specifications.
Perform system analysis, coding, testing, debugging, and documentation of mainframe applications.
Collaborate with cross-functional teams, including business analysts and project managers, to deliver high-quality software solutions.
Troubleshoot and resolve production issues related to mainframe applications.
Participate in code reviews and ensure adherence to coding standards and best practices.
Stay current with emerging trends and technologies in mainframe development.
Skills:
Operating systems: IBM z/OS, AIX, Linux (Red Hat), Windows,
Mainframe: COBOL, CICS, DB2, JCL, VSAM, TSO/ISPF, Easytrieve, Endevor , CA7, Control M, BMC AMI DevX Code Pipeline
Relational databases: DB2, Oracle
